Class TukeyMeanDifferencePlot

java.lang.Object
tech.tablesaw.plotly.api.TukeyMeanDifferencePlot

public class TukeyMeanDifferencePlot extends Object
A Tukey Mean-Difference Plot (AKA a Bland-Altman plot) is a kind of scatter plot used frequently in medicine, biology and other fields, is used to visualize the differences between two quantitative measurements. In particular, it is often used to evaluate whether two tests produce 'the same' result.

For two numeric arrays, a and b, the plot shows the mean for each pair of observations (a + b) / 2, as well as the differences between them: a - b.

  • Method Details

    • create

      public static Figure create(String title, String measure, tech.tablesaw.api.Table table, String columnName1, String columnName2)
      Returns a figure containing a Tukey Mean-Difference Plot describing the differences between the data in two columns of interest
      Parameters:
      title - A title for the plot
      measure - The measure being compared on the plot (e.g "inches" or "height in inches"
      table - The table containing the columns of interest
      columnName1 - The name of the first numeric column containing the data to plot
      columnName2 - The name of the second numeric column containing the data to plot
